     Checking conditions of the cutting edge • Check wear conditions of and damage to the cutting edge. • If there is serious damage such as fracture on t he cutting edge, grind the edg e until the damage is all gone.  Grinding first r elief face • Install the drill by using collet chuck.      Grinding thinning face • After grinding second relief face, grind thinning face. Type of the thinning is X-thinning . • First, set the work head horizontal so that the center of the drill will be horizontal. Drill rotation angle is 0°.
